Output e8691499978f01da9e1e68013fcfb4a94ed8c949e511b85c3c0def4d8f83caa9:14

value
38860
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 a781afe6f78450a4ea6b09e2ab38ae0baa7d4abc5483785818efa911946005d3
address
bc1p57q6lehhs3g2f6ntp832kw9wpw486j4u2jphskqca753r9rqqhfsnexhd0
transaction
e8691499978f01da9e1e68013fcfb4a94ed8c949e511b85c3c0def4d8f83caa9
spent
true